Ocean Freight Services Singapore to China: Seamless Maritime Movement

For businesses transporting large volumes or non-urgent goods, Ocean Freight Services Singapore to China offers a cost-effective and reliable option. Ocean shipping is ideal for bulk commodities, electronics, machinery, and raw materials. With consistent sailing schedules and full-container or less-than-container options, sea freight remains a preferred choice for many industries.

Logistics providers offering ocean freight between Singapore and China handle route planning, port operations, customs processing, and container loading—all tailored to meet tight shipping timelines and specific cargo requirements. This structured, end-to-end coordination allows companies to optimize shipping spend while maintaining cargo integrity.

Road Freight Logistics: Connecting Ports to Inland Destinations

In an integrated logistics system, Road Freight Logistics plays a vital role by bridging the gap between seaports, airports, and final destinations. Whether in China or Singapore, last-mile delivery via road networks ensures that goods reach retailers, warehouses, or consumers safely and on schedule.

Trucking services can include full truckload (FTL) or less-than-truckload (LTL) depending on your shipment size. An established road freight partner manages everything from route optimization and fleet coordination to customs transit permits, especially for time-sensitive or high-value goods. With growing e-commerce demand, agile and scalable road transport is now more important than ever.

Freight Cost from China to Singapore: Understanding Pricing Dynamics

Calculating the Freight Cost from China to Singapore requires evaluating various components including shipping method (air, sea, road), cargo weight/volume, incoterms, destination handling fees, and customs duties. Sea freight tends to be the most economical option for heavier loads, while air freight is preferred for urgent deliveries.

An experienced logistics provider offers transparent quotes with detailed breakdowns, helping businesses make informed decisions. With optimized shipping strategies and volume-based pricing, companies can reduce overall logistics expenses while maintaining consistent delivery timelines.
